· A special prospecting licence costs 600 and these allows the holder to prospect in approved areas anywhere in Zimbabwe. Registration fees depend on type of mineral being mined. For precious metals the fees costs 200 and its valid for 2 years. There after renewal costs 100 and valid for a year. Other fees are as follows,base Minerals costs ...

· Zimbabwe threatens to withdraw mining licenses over unpaid fees. HARARE (Reuters) Zimbabwe has given holders of mining concessions up to the end of April to pay 11 million in outstanding annual fees or risk losing their licenses, the mines minister said on Tuesday.
